首頁 > web前端 > css教學 > 如何優化 CSS「背景圖片」的使用以獲得更好的效能和瀏覽器相容性?

如何優化 CSS「背景圖片」的使用以獲得更好的效能和瀏覽器相容性?

Barbara Streisand
發布: 2024-12-14 14:10:17
原創
954 人瀏覽過

How Can I Optimize CSS `background-image` Usage for Better Performance and Browser Compatibility?

最佳化 CSS 背景圖片使用

CSS 背景圖片屬性是自訂元素視覺吸引力的強大工具。了解其正確用法對於確保其跨瀏覽器的兼容性至關重要。

影像路徑所需的引號

與提供的範例相反,background-image 中的影像路徑確實不需要引號。您可以使用直接URI 指定它:

background-image: url(image.jpg);
登入後複製

但是,如果路徑包含括號或空格等特殊字符,則需要引號:

background-image: url("image with spaces.jpg");
登入後複製

相對與. 完整路徑

您可以在背景影像中使用相對路徑或完整路徑。相對路徑是指同一目錄中的影像,而完整 URL 則指定影像的確切位置。例如:

  • 相對路徑:url(images/slide/background.jpg)
  • 完整網址:url(https://example.com/images/slide/background.jpg ) jpg)

其他注意事項

  • 瀏覽器相容性:確保所有主流瀏覽器都支援影像格式(例如JPG、PNG)。
  • 快取問題: 避免使用動態影像 URL(例如 PHP 腳本),因為它們可能會導致快取問題。
  • 圖片大小:最佳化圖片大小以減少頁面載入時間並提高效能。
  • 使用後備:考慮使用不同的後備背景顏色或圖像,以防主圖像無法載入。

透過遵循這些建議,您可以有效地利用背景圖像屬性來創建具有視覺吸引力且符合標準的網頁設計。

以上是如何優化 CSS「背景圖片」的使用以獲得更好的效能和瀏覽器相容性?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板